Clinton Addresses Hot Tub Photo And Allegations Of Liking Women “Young”

A Democratic lawmaker asked questions about a photo that showed Bill Clinton in a pool with a woman whose face was redacted. The former president said he did not know the woman and did not engage in sexual activity with her. He said the photo was from a trip to Brunei for charitable work. Additionally, Clinton said a number of people in their travel party were swimming. He also said that he was not aware that one young woman who was ostensibly working as a masseuse and gave him a neck massage on one flight was in fact a victim of sexual abuse.

“There’s nothing that I saw when I was around him that made me realize he was trafficking women,” Bill Clinton told the committee.

 

Bill Clinton said he had once visited Jeffrey Epstein’s townhouse in New York City. However, he said repeatedly he had never visited Epstein’s private island or other properties.

 

Asked by Republicans whether they had talked about young women or girls together, Clinton responded emphatically: “No.” A video of that line of questioning has also gone viral.

Also, Bill Clinton acknowledged he maintained a closer relationship with Ghislaine Maxwell, Epstein’s former girlfriend and confidant. But he maintained that was largely because of close mutual connections. He also said “she has to be punished” for her conviction on sex trafficking charges.

What Else Did Clinton Say About His Ties To Jeffrey?

The viral video of Bill Clinton smiling at throwback photos stems from Republicans and Democrats questioning him about said pictures, which the government released with the Jeffrey Epstein files. Clinton said he first remembered meeting Epstein when he flew aboard his private jet in 2002. At the time, they were traveling for his and Hillary Clintons’ humanitarian work.

Overall, Bill Clinton described his relationship with Epstein as a little more than “cordial.” He stuck by that answer even when the subject was the note he wrote for Epstein’s 50th birthday. Also, regarding their travel, Bill Clinton described an arrangement with Jeffrey Epstein. The Clintons got use of his private jet for humanitarian trips in exchange for Bill Clinton discussing politics and economics with him.

Clinton testified that Larry Summers, who had worked as treasury secretary in Clinton’s administration, helped make that connection. But Clinton said they went separate ways in 2003 after he sensed that Epstein was not deeply interested in the humanitarian work.

“We were friendly, but I didn’t know him well enough to say we were friends,” he said.

Epstein visited the White House numerous times during Clinton’s presidency. There are photos of them shaking hands. Still, Clinton told lawmakers he did not recall those interactions.

Bill Clinton Speaks On Donald Trump 

One line of questioning stirred up curiosity from lawmakers. That was what Clinton had to say about President Donald Trump. He made clear he believed it was important for anyone, including presidents, to come forward and testify to their knowledge of Jeffrey Epstein. Clinton also shared how he and Trump had briefly discussed Epstein at a charity golf tournament more than 20 years ago. He said Trump had never “said anything to me to make me think he was involved in anything improper with regard to Epstein.” However, he also remarked that those two men had a falling-out over a real estate deal.
